#0CD3DC Hex Color Code

#0CD3DC

The Hexadecimal Color #0CD3DC is a contrast shade of Dark Turquoise. #0CD3DC RGB value is rgb(12, 211, 220). RGB Color Model of #0CD3DC consists of 4% red, 82% green and 86% blue. HSL color Mode of #0CD3DC has 183°(degrees) Hue, 90% Saturation and 45% Lightness. #0CD3DC color has an wavelength of 504.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#0CD3DC is #33F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#0CD3DC is #1CD. The Closest Color to #0CD3DC is #00CED1. Official Name of #0CD3DC Hex Code is Robin's Egg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#0CD3DC is 95 Cyan 4 Magenta 0 Yellow 14 Black and #0CD3DC CMY is 95, 4,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#0CD3DC is hsl(183,90,45,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(183, 95, 86).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#0CD3DC is 36.36, 51.83, 75.78.
Hex8 Value of #0CD3DC is #0CD3DCFF. Decimal Value of #0CD3DC is 840668 and Octal Value of #0CD3DC is 3151734. Binary Value of #0CD3DC is 1100, 11010011, 11011100 and Android of #0CD3DC is 4279030748 / 0xff0cd3dc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#0CD3DC is 0.222, 0.316, 0.316 and YIQ Color Space of #0CD3DC is 152.525, -121.4758, -39.2877.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#0CD3DC is 36.6, 62.86, 75.34.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#0CD3DC is 77.18, -38.67, -16.59.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#0CD3DC is 77.18, -58.34, -20.39.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#0CD3DC is 77.18, 42.08, 203.22. Hunter Lab variable of #0CD3DC is 71.99, -35.84, -12.01.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#0CD3DC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
